July Weather in Sola, Vanuatu

Last updated: August 28, 2025

In Sola, Vanuatu, the average temperature in July hovers around 26°C (79°F). The weather can vary slightly, with a minimum of 24°C (76°F) and a maximum reaching 28°C (82°F). Expect 110 mm (4.3 in) of precipitation spread over 18 days, contributing to an average humidity of 80%.

July Humidity in Sola

In Sola in July humidity is 80%. With an average temperature of 26°C (79°F), this humidity feels like a heavy blanket, making outdoor activities feel sticky and exhausting, potentially dampening the travel experience and necessitating frequent breaks to cool down and hydrate.

July UV Index in Sola

In Sola in July, the maximum UV index reaches 10, which corresponds to a very high Exposure Category. With a time to burn of just 15 minutes, it's crucial to take precautions. For more detailed information, you can check the Hourly UV Index in Sola.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
